Databricks MCP Servers vs Memory (Knowledge Graph)
A side-by-side comparison of two AI, Data & Knowledge servers — tools, transport, auth, maintenance, and copy-paste config for each.
| Databricks MCP Servers Databricks Labs server exposing Unity Catalog functions, vector search indexes and Genie spaces as agent tools. Unverified stdio (local) OAuth Stale Python | Memory (Knowledge Graph) Official MCP server providing persistent, file-backed knowledge-graph memory across sessions. Verified stdio (local) No auth TypeScript | |
|---|---|---|
| Category | AI, Data & Knowledge | AI, Data & Knowledge |
| Language | Python | TypeScript |
| Transport | stdio (local) | stdio (local) |
| Auth | OAuth | None |
| GitHub stars | 93 | 74k |
| Last commit | 11 months ago | 5 months ago |
| Verified | ||
| Actively maintained | ||
| Install | git clone https://github.com/databrickslabs/mcp && uv --directory ./mcp run unitycatalog-mcp -s your_catalog.your_schema | npx -y @modelcontextprotocol/server-memory |
| Repo | Open | Open |
Verdict
Pick Databricks MCP Servers if you prefer its approach (databricks labs server exposing unity catalog functions, vector search indexes and genie spaces as agent tools).
Pick Memory (Knowledge Graph) if you prefer the more popular, battle-tested option, and you want zero-setup with no API key.
Add Databricks MCP Servers
git clone https://github.com/databrickslabs/mcp && uv --directory ./mcp run unitycatalog-mcp -s your_catalog.your_schemaPaste into ~/Library/Application Support/Claude/claude_desktop_config.json
{
"mcpServers": {
"databricks-mcp-servers": {
"command": "/path/to/uv/executable/uv",
"args": [
"--directory",
"/path/to/this/repo",
"run",
"unitycatalog-mcp",
"-s",
"your_catalog.your_schema",
"-g",
"genie_space_id_1,genie_space_id_2"
]
}
}
}Add Memory (Knowledge Graph)
npx -y @modelcontextprotocol/server-memoryPaste into ~/Library/Application Support/Claude/claude_desktop_config.json
{
"mcpServers": {
"memory-knowledge-graph": {
"command": "npx",
"args": [
"-y",
"@modelcontextprotocol/server-memory"
],
"env": {
"MEMORY_FILE_PATH": "/absolute/path/to/memory.jsonl"
}
}
}
}FAQ
Databricks MCP Servers or Memory (Knowledge Graph) — which is better?
Pick Databricks MCP Servers if you prefer its approach (databricks labs server exposing unity catalog functions, vector search indexes and genie spaces as agent tools). Pick Memory (Knowledge Graph) if you prefer the more popular, battle-tested option, and you want zero-setup with no API key.
Can I use both Databricks MCP Servers and Memory (Knowledge Graph)?
Yes — MCP clients let you enable multiple servers at once. Add both configs to your client's mcpServers and use whichever tool fits the task.
Do Databricks MCP Servers and Memory (Knowledge Graph) work with Claude, Cursor and Windsurf?
Both do. Copy the per-client config below into Claude Desktop, Cursor, or Windsurf.